Cyprus national competition ‘Twin Cities’ for the creation of a sculpture in the Limassol waterfront sculpture park
Organiser: Limassol Municipality.
One of two winners.
The artwork was constructed and installed in position in summer 2000.
Framed Views: Sculpture proposal for the Limassol Reclamation Park.
Description
This work focuses on framing specific views of the reclamation environment and thus creating dramatic focal points from both perspectives. One of the objectives of the sculpture will be to encourage spectator participation, to pause and look through and beyond the artwork. Two chairs are positioned on either end of the construction. This furniture will encourage the pedestrians to participate in the artwork by sitting in the chairs. Their over scaled dimensions will stimulate childhood memories of the sitter as well as offering them an out of the ordinary experience. This, hopefully, will encourage a freshness of perception to their environment.
During the evening the artwork becomes self referential and creates its own atmosphere and form. This is achieved with the use of various coloured neon or other suitable equivalent.
